05. What is the proof-of-meditation technology and how does it work?

For the user the proof-of-meditation technology is very simple, they just need to use the MEMO sensor and use the meditation app that helps in the meditation practice as if it were a game.

Technically the proof-of-meditation is the technology that allows to verify with extreme precision and security the meditative state of the user and validate the payment in a 100% safe way.

The meditation proof technology works through a portable and wearable neurofeedback device, the MEMO sensor, connected to the Money of Good app. The app then performs the cryptographic recording of the meditator's mental signals along with various other information in the holochain, a distributed accounting ledger like the blockchain. This unique and indelible record authorizes the system to pay monetary credits to the user in the new currency called GOOD.

08. What is the MEMO and how does it work?

MEMO is a wearable device that measures brain activity via electroencephalography (EEG) sensors. This technology is similar to other devices already available on the market that offer guidance for relaxation and meditation. Example: Muse, Emotiv, Mindlift, Melomind, and Neurosky.

The data measured by MEMO is used to generate instant feedback via the App on the smartphone where a graphical + audio interface that looks like a game guides the user in a personalized way in his meditation practice.

Note: The MEMO sensor is just a brainwave meter. It does not emit any kind of signal that can interfere with brain activity.

10. Is there a limit of GOODs credits a person can earn per day?

Yes, there is a daily limit of how many GOODs a person can earn. This limit corresponds to the maximum time of 4h of meditation per day. As the Money of Good platform will start paying the equivalent of 1 dollar per minute of practice, 4h will yield approximately 240.00 G per day. The equivalent of 240 dollars or 972.00 reais (at the rate of 08.10.19 - 1.00 dollar = 4.05 reais).

12. Where does the money come from to pay people?

The GOOD money to pay users will come from the Money of Good monetary fund which is generated as follows:

- through wearable MEMO sales

- through donations from foundations and organizations that support the Future of Good

- through the credit reserve fund generated by companies associated with the Money of Good system and the new conscious economy of the common good.
